Irish Boxty

Irish Boxty
Irish Boxty. Photo credit: The Kitchen Magpie.

This delicious Irish boxty recipe is potato pancakes (or crepes) using leftover mashed potatoes & grated potatoes in a batter & then fried up!

Colcannon (Irish Potatoes)

Colcannon (Irish Potatoes)
Colcannon (Irish Potatoes). Photo credit: The Kitchen Magpie.

Colcannon, also known as Irish potatoes, are creamy, buttery mashed potatoes that are loaded with fried onions, cabbage, green onions, and bacon.
